The Searchloom nightly reindex rebuilds the Pellbrook catalog between 02:00 and 04:00. If the job wedges mid-shard, normal operator tokens cannot cancel it; cancellation requires the break-glass role, which is deliberately kept offline. Use it only after confirming the shard coordinator is truly stalled (no heartbeat for 15 minutes) and after paging the Wrenholt on-call lead. Record your reason in the access log before proceeding. To assume the break-glass role, supply the recovery passphrase shown below.

vault phrase of bafop-kahop = sormir-frador

Onboarding: tailcat CLI

Use tailcat to stream logs from the Verro staging pods. Standard flags: -f follows, -n sets lookback, --svc targets a service. Don't tail prod without a review buddy. First run prompts for keystore setup; when it asks for the recovery passphrase, enter the one below.

vault phrase of yajog-kagep = praax-oliwyn

**Vendor note: Inkmill markdown pipeline**

Rendering for Parchway docs is outsourced to Inkmill under an annual contract, renewing each March. They handle sanitization and PDF export; we own the upload queue. SLA: 4-hour response on rendering failures. Escalate only after two failed retries. Their support desk is reachable at the address below.

billing contact of hahaf-baguf = zorael.tammir.jorius@sivrelhq.internal

**Mgmt Meeting Minutes — Retiring the Brightline Range**

Quick recap for sales leads at Fenholt Supplies: we agreed to retire the Brightline fixture range by year-end. Remaining stock moves to clearance pricing next month, and accounts on standing orders get migrated to the Lumetta range. Trade-in incentives were approved in principle. The confidential note on next steps sits just below.

board note of bajof-bajeg: The pricing group signed off on a budget of $13.4 million for Project Sildor. The renewal with Lamixek Holdings closes at $48.9 million a year, 49 percent above the last contract.